The characters mentioned in the question belong to the play "A Doll's House" by Henrik Ibsen.

<h3>Use the drop-down menus to select the character that best completes each sentence.  </h3>
  • Threatens to reveal Nora's indiscretions - Krogstad
  • Does not trust Nora and thinks that she cannot act responsibly- Helmer
  • Has been a longtime friend of Nora's - Mrs. Linde.
  • Acts silly but is a lot more resourceful than some think-  Nora

<h3>Characters of the story is:</h3>

Nora: is hitched to Torvald Helmer. Has been treated as a toy, a doll, for what seems like forever, continually being determined what to do, first by her dad and afterward by her better half.

Director: Nora's better half. Chauvinist and oblivious. Considers himself to be Nora's friend in need and expert. Regards Nora as though she were mediocre and unequipped for having an independent perspective.

Krogstad: works at a similar bank as Helmer. Is familiar with Nora's wrongdoing. Takes steps to uncover her insider facts to her better half. Has been enamored with Mrs. Linde previously.

Mrs. Linde: a widow, companions with Nora for quite a while. Reunites with Krogstad subsequent to promising to help Nora.
